Chapter 5 - Section 5.1 - Adding and Subtracting Polynomials - Exercise Set - Page 349: 44

Answer

$-\displaystyle \frac{5}{12}x^{9}+\frac{7}{15}x^{5}-1.7$

Work Step by Step

$ \begin{array}{lllll} & \frac{1}{3}x^{9} & -\frac{1}{5}x^{5} & -2.7 & \\ +( & -\frac{3}{4}x^{9} & +\frac{2}{3}x^{5} & +1 & )\\ \hline & & & & \\ = & (\frac{1}{3}-\frac{3}{4})x^{9} & +(-\frac{1}{5}+\frac{2}{3})x^{5} & +(-2.7+1) & \\ & & & & \\ = & \frac{4-9}{12}x^{9} & +\frac{-3+10}{15}x^{5} & -1.7 & \\ & & & & \\ = & -\frac{5}{12}x^{9} & +\frac{7}{15}x^{5} & -1.7 & \end{array} $
